SOUND FAMILIAR?

An open house has no start and no end — that is the hard part

Everyone arrives in the same half hour

An invitation that says come any time is widely read as come at the beginning, and the room fills before the food is ready.

The graduate repeats the same greeting all day

Every new arrival restarts the same short conversation, and by mid-afternoon the honoree is worn out and only half present.

Food empties, then reappears

Refilling happens whenever someone notices a bare tray, so early guests see too much and late ones meet a picked-over table.

Nobody can tell when it is over

With no closing signal, the last group settles in for hours and the host cannot start clearing without appearing rude.
